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om Outer Mill Vly Corte Madera Sausalito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Outer Mill Vly Corte Madera Sausalito with 2 Bedroom?

Currently the most affordable 2 Bedroom in Outer Mill Vly Corte Madera Sausalito is at Summit at Sausalito listed at $2,766.

How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om Outer Mill Vly Corte Madera Sausalito Apartment?

The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in Outer Mill Vly Corte Madera Sausalito is $4,315.

What is the largest available 2 Bedroom Outer Mill Vly Corte Madera Sausalito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Outer Mill Vly Corte Madera Sausalito is a 1,180 square feet unit starting from $3,931 at Skylark Apartments.

What is the average size for Outer Mill Vly Corte Madera Sausalito 2 Bedroom Apartments for rent?

The average size for a 2 Bedroom rental in Outer Mill Vly Corte Madera Sausalito is currently 1,202 sq ft.
